What Is Uniswap? A Complete Beginner's Guide

The Uniswap protocol is an open source peer-to-peer decentralized exchange. Immutable, persistent, non-upgradable smart contracts on the Ethereum …

Uniswap is a decentralized cryptocurrency exchange built on the Ethereum blockchain. It operates as an automated liquidity protocol, enabling users to trade Ethereum-based tokens directly from their wallets without the need for intermediaries or centralized exchanges. Uniswap utilizes smart contracts to facilitate peer-to-peer token swaps and liquidity provision, offering a unique decentralized trading experience.

Here's a comprehensive overview of the Uniswap exchange:

  1. Decentralized Exchange (DEX): Uniswap is a decentralized exchange that operates on the Ethereum blockchain. It removes the need for a central authority to match buyers and sellers, allowing users to trade directly with each other.

  2. Automated Market Maker (AMM): Uniswap utilizes an automated market maker model, which relies on liquidity pools rather than order books. Liquidity providers deposit pairs of tokens into these pools, and Uniswap's algorithm automatically determines token prices based on the ratio of tokens in each pool.

  3. Token Swaps: Uniswap allows users to swap ERC-20 tokens directly from their Ethereum wallets. Users can specify the token they want to trade and the desired token they want to receive. The exchange algorithmically determines the exchange rate based on the available liquidity in the pools, ensuring efficient and immediate token swaps.

  4. Liquidity Provision: Uniswap relies on liquidity providers who deposit an equal value of two tokens into a liquidity pool. In return, they receive liquidity provider (LP) tokens that represent their share of the pool. Liquidity providers earn trading fees proportionate to their share of the pool, incentivizing them to provide liquidity to the platform.

  5. Trading Fees: Uniswap charges a 0.3% fee on each token swap, which is distributed among liquidity providers. This fee incentivizes liquidity provision and ensures that the protocol remains sustainable.

  6. Decentralization and Security: As a decentralized exchange, Uniswap offers enhanced security and transparency compared to centralized exchanges. Users maintain control of their funds throughout the trading process, reducing the risk of hacks or theft associated with centralized custody.

  7. Permissionless Listing: Uniswap's decentralized nature enables any ERC-20 token to be listed on the platform. Tokens can be listed without requiring approval or permission from a central authority, providing more opportunities for token projects and fostering an open and inclusive ecosystem.

  8. Uniswap V2 and V3: Uniswap has released multiple versions of its protocol. Uniswap V2 introduced new features and enhancements, while Uniswap V3 introduced concentrated liquidity, enabling liquidity providers to define custom price ranges for their assets.

  9. Front-End Interfaces: While Uniswap provides the protocol and underlying smart contracts, various front-end interfaces have been developed to interact with the exchange, such as the official Uniswap website, third-party applications, and decentralized finance (DeFi) aggregators.

  10. Ecosystem and Integrations: Uniswap has a vibrant ecosystem with a diverse range of projects and integrations. It has become a fundamental component of the Ethereum DeFi ecosystem, powering various decentralized applications, liquidity protocols, and decentralized finance innovations.

It's important to note that the cryptocurrency space is rapidly evolving, and there may have been updates or changes to the Uniswap protocol since my last knowledge update in September 2021. To get the most accurate and up-to-date information, I recommend visiting the official Uniswap website and exploring the resources provided by the Uniswap community.

Last updated